Gene details (from Flybase) It is a protein_coding_gene from Drosophila melanogaster.
There is experimental evidence that it has the molecular function: protein binding.
The biological processes in which it is involved are not known.
4 alleles are reported.
The phenotype of these alleles is annotated with: mesothoracic tergum.
It has 3 annotated transcripts and 3 annotated polypeptides.
Protein features are: Domain of unknown function DUF2013; Src homology-3 domain.
Summary of modENCODE Temporal Expression Profile: Temporal profile ranges from a peak of moderately high expression to a trough of low expression.
Peak expression observed within 00-06 hour embryonic stages, in adult female stages.
